Here’s a breakdown of what makes up the score and the standings:
- Game Scores: This is the most basic element. The score tells us who won and by how much. It includes runs scored by both the Blue Jays and their opponent.
- Wins and Losses (W-L): This is the most important part of the standings. This shows the total number of games won and lost by the Blue Jays. For example, if the Blue Jays have 20 wins and 10 losses, it’s shown as 20-10.
- Winning Percentage: It is calculated by dividing wins by the total number of games played. This number helps to compare teams with different numbers of games played.
- Games Back (GB): This shows how many games behind the Blue Jays are from the leading team in their division. This number gives you a quick snapshot of how they’re doing relative to the competition.
- Division and League Standings: The Blue Jays play in the American League East division, so their division standings are critical. The league standings show how they stack up against all teams in the American League. These are super important for playoff implications.

Division Standings
The Blue Jays play in the American League East (AL East), one of the most competitive divisions in baseball. Here’s how division standings work:
- Ranking: Teams in the AL East are ranked based on their winning percentage. The team with the highest winning percentage is at the top.
- Games Back: This shows how many games behind the leading team the Blue Jays are. This tells you how far the Jays are from first place.
- Key Teams: In the AL East, the Blue Jays go up against strong teams, such as the New York Yankees, Boston Red Sox, Tampa Bay Rays, and Baltimore Orioles. So, the division standings give a clear view of where the team stands against these rivals.
League Standings
Beyond the division, the Blue Jays also compete in the American League (AL). Here's how the league standings play out:
- Ranking: All teams in the AL are ranked based on winning percentage. This lets you compare the Blue Jays with teams in other divisions.
- Playoff Spots: The top teams from the AL qualify for the playoffs. The standings are essential for determining who makes it to the postseason.
- Wild Card Race: There are also Wild Card spots for teams with good records but who didn’t win their division. This adds more teams to the mix and keeps the competition exciting.
Playoff Implications
The standings are very important because they directly impact the Blue Jays' chances of making the playoffs.
- Division Winner: Winning the AL East guarantees a spot in the playoffs. This means home-field advantage and a chance to compete for a World Series title.
- Wild Card Berth: Even if the Jays don't win the division, they can still make the playoffs as a Wild Card team. This usually means a play-in game before the division series.
- Postseason Push: Every game counts as the season progresses. The standings constantly change, so it's essential to follow the team's progress.

Key Stats to Watch
- Batting Average: This statistic tells you how often the team is getting hits. A higher batting average means more hits, which means more chances to score runs. Keep track of who is hitting the ball.
- On-Base Percentage (OBP): This indicates how often a hitter reaches base. A higher OBP means the team gets more runners on base, which then increases the chance of scoring. This is key to evaluating an offense.
- Earned Run Average (ERA): ERA measures the average number of earned runs a pitcher gives up per game. A lower ERA means a pitcher is effective and doesn’t give up many runs. This helps you track the effectiveness of the pitching staff.
- Home Runs: The number of home runs tells you how often the team is scoring big runs. Tracking home runs is very important for an offensive assessment.
- Runs Batted In (RBI): RBI measure how many runs are driven in by the team. Having players who can get runners across home plate is key. This is a very useful stat for evaluating the offense.
